The Imagine Crafts IW000910 Irresistible Pico Embellisher is a compact and versatile crafting tool designed to elevate your DIY projects. With dimensions of 2.5 inches in length, 4.0 inches in width, and 5.5 inches in height, this USA-made embellisher is perfect for adding intricate details to wedding dresses and other creative endeavors.
